DrugCVar
DrugCVar provides evidence-based drug annotations for cancer-associated genetic variants to support interpretation for targeted therapy.
Key Features:
- Integration of Evidence Sources: Aggregates evidence from CIViC, OncoKB, CGI (The Cancer Genome Interpreter), and My Cancer Genome to compile clinical interpretations of cancer variants.
- Manually Curated Data: Contains 7,830 clinically relevant evidences curated from the literature and classified into ten evidence tiers.
- Batch Annotation Module: Supports batch annotation of user-provided genetic variants in various formats for high-throughput analyses.
- Detailed Variant Information: Reports mutation function, genomic and protein location, and mutation statistics across tumor types for queried genes and variants.
- Search and Retrieval Functions: Provides mechanisms to retrieve specific variant–drug targeting evidence and associated annotations.
Scientific Applications:
- Precision oncology decision support: Enables interpretation of therapeutic options for cancer-related genetic variants using evidence-based annotations.
- Research on mutation–drug interactions: Facilitates exploration of relationships between specific variants and drug responses across datasets.
- Variant impact analysis across cancers: Supports comparative analysis of mutation frequencies and functional consequences across tumor types.
Methodology:
Data integration from CIViC, OncoKB, CGI, and My Cancer Genome combined with manual literature curation, and classification of evidences into ten tiers.
